Kiev, Ukraine. After several days of violent clashes, culminating in around a hundred deaths among protesters and dozens of police officers captured and held hostage, President Yanukovych and his government sat down to negotiate and signed an agreement that led to a truce in street fighting. The agreement provides for a return to the 2004 constitution and new elections. At the same time, parliament voted on a justice reform that also included Tymoshenko’s release.
